Walibi Holland Discussion Thread
RCT3Bross replied to robbalvey's topic in Theme Parks, Roller Coasters, & Donkeys!
Walibi Holland Isn't going to sit still after the opening of Lost Gravity this year. In 2019 the park is going to invest again in a brand new coaster. Thats what CEO Mascha van Till promises in a interview. She isn't ready for any details. But Van Till said that the budget will be bigger then Lost Gravity, that will open next month. "It will be something completely different. We always look for things that you can't find in other parks." Also in 2017 Walibi will open something new. The working title 'Brain Trip', reveals the boss on "BNR Nieuwsradio". "It's going to be something of an other caliber. You're going to experience something." There at least won't be any virtual reality goggles. according to the Ceo of Walibi they don't look at other parks for inspiration. Van Till lets herself be inspired by other companies. "What are big players in the theater-world doing? What can you find in the stores?" Source Looopings.nl Well nothing about Lost Gravity but this promises so much for this park future.
